O'Charley's - O'Charley's Baby Back Ribs has a very high-calorie, average-carb, very high-fat and very high-protein content. It is a good source of Vitamin A.
The food contains 38g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is low in complex carbs and high in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. Its high sugar content puts it in the bottom 20 percentile. This is a good thing for people watching their sugar intake. With 39 gms of protein, it is very high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Because of its very high fat content, it could be unsuitable option, especially if you're watching your fat intake for health reasons. A quick glance at the fat profile reveals that it is very high in saturated fats and low in trans fats. It's low MUFA and low PUFA. In terms of Polyunsaturated Fat content it is ranked in the bottom 20% of all food items. It is also ranked in the bottom 20 percentile in terms of its Monounsaturated Fat content, which are considered among "good fats".
While Sodium is an essential nutrient, excess quantities can cause several disorders like fluid retention, hypertension. Since it has a very high density of Sodium, it is unsuitable if you are aiming for a healthy, low-sodium diet.
Our comprehensive nutrition ranking methodology, which inspects every nutrition element that this food is composed of, comes up with a nutrition ranking of 77, for O'Charley's - O'Charley's Baby Back Ribs, and we advise that this food in moderation.

Serving size
Amount Per Serving
Calories 740 Calories from Fat 430
% Daily Value *
Total Fat 48 g 73.8%
Saturated Fat 17 g 85%
Trans Fat 0 g
Cholesterol 185 mg 61.7%
Sodium 2630 mg 109.6%
Total Carbohydrates 38 g 12.7%
Dietary Fiber 2 g8%
Sugars 26 g
Protein 39 g 78%
Vitamin A 30% Vitamin C 2%
Calcium 0.6% Iron 15%
*Based on a 2000 Calorie diet
